So, how do you find the right fit? Start by looking for camps within a reasonable drive from Tolley—perhaps in nearby communities like Mohall or Minot. Don't just search online; ask for personal recommendations at the Tolley Post Office or from fellow pet parents at the Renville County Fair. When you contact a camp, ask specific questions: What is their staff-to-dog ratio? How do they group dogs by size and temperament? What is their protocol for a scraped paw or a sudden summer thunderstorm? A reputable camp will welcome these questions and may even offer a meet-and-greet or a trial half-day.
To prepare your pup for their big day, ensure their vaccinations are up-to-date—a must in any communal setting. Pack a simple bag with their food (if they'll be there over lunch), a familiar comfort item, and a note about any quirks, like being nervous around large male dogs or having a favorite game.
